What is the population of Vanderburgh County, IN?
Vanderburgh County in Indiana has a population of 179,908, per Census ACS 5-Year estimates. The median household income is $60,938 and the median age is 38.9.
Context
Counties are the primary administrative subdivisions of states and a stable unit for tracking population. Vanderburgh County's population reflects everyone within county lines, including residents of incorporated cities and unincorporated areas.
